Abstract

We demonstrate a new technique to measure the temporal coherence length of mode-locked laser pulses. As suggested by Johnson et al.,1 we make each laser pulse interfere with itself in a photorefractive crystal. However, we improve on their technique by encoding different time delays across a single laser beam, so that the entire electric field autocorrelation function can be determined in essentially real time (a few milliseconds).
